Output 8617df74b6063d8de1a82521f90344fee8aae3567f035cf8d518d0bf202aeb4f:1

value
188488521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c917d81256ccf9ca442844a2709aaa9af73092df OP_EQUAL
address
3L2JJpAEHiNMHJQqp45uQwBe4R6PJuDn22
transaction
8617df74b6063d8de1a82521f90344fee8aae3567f035cf8d518d0bf202aeb4f
confirmations
365605
spent
true